Red Cross Society of Colombia

Unverified non-profit organisation

The Red Cross Society of Colombia was established as an independent organisation in 1915, and joined the international Red Cross Movement in 1922. Because of the ongoing conflict in Colombia, the Society currently focuses primarily on disaster relief and the provision of humanitarian assistance to people displaced either by natural disasters or by conflict. The Society runs relief programmes in partnership with UN agencies, the national government and the International Federation of Red Cross and Red Crescent Societies which has been present in Colombia since 1969.
